概括
本研究介绍了使用非线性施罗丁格方程在非局部非线性介质中的矢量多极单极子和旋光学单极子集群的近似分析解决方案. 结果显示,单子结构取决于调制深度和拓电荷,在传播过程中可以观察到旋转.

背景情况:
- 非线性施罗丁格方程 (NLSE) 对于描述在非线性介质中的波传播至关重要.
- 非局部非线性媒体 (NNM) 引入了局部模型无法捕获的独特行为.
研究的目的:
- 为矢量多极单极子和旋光学单极子集群推导近似分析解决方案.
- 为了研究调制深度和拓电荷对单子结构的影响.
- 分析空间单子的传播动态,包括旋转.
主要方法:
- 对NLSE应用的变量方法.
- 对矢量多极单极子和旋光学单极子集群的分析.
- 检查单体生物的繁殖和结构演变.
主要成果:
- 获得了向量多极单极子和旋光学单极子集群的近似分析解决方案.
- 证明调制深度和拓电荷决定了单子结构.
- 在传播过程中观察到空间单体旋转,并有可能退化为圆形对称单体.
结论:
- 变化方法为复杂的单体结构提供了有效的近似解决方案.
- 在NNM中,soliton的行为可以通过像调制深度和拓电荷这样的参数来调整.
- 这些发现对设计和控制各种物理系统中的光学单子传播有意义.

Dimensionless groups in fluid mechanics provide simplified ratios that help analyze fluid behavior without relying on specific units. The Reynolds number (Re), which represents the ratio of inertial to viscous forces, distinguishes between laminar and turbulent flows, making it essential in the design of pipelines and aerodynamic surfaces.
